  • Patent number: 10907392
    Abstract: A method of pivoting an aircraft storage bin that includes a bucket that pivots with respect to an upper housing. The method includes pivoting the bucket from a closed position to an intermediate position and placing weight that exceeds a predetermined weight threshold in the bucket, thereby causing the bucket to move to an open position. Movement of the bucket to the open position causes a lift assist unit to activate. A first end of the lift assist unit is connected to the bucket and a second end of the lift assist unit is connected to the upper housing. The method also includes pivoting the bucket from the open position to the closed position. The lift assist unit provides assistance as the bucket is pivoting from the open position to the closed position.

  • Patent number: 10000286
    Abstract: An aircraft storage bin that includes an upper housing, a bucket that cooperates with the upper housing to define a bin interior and is pivotally connected to the upper housing, and at least a first assist spring having a spring force. The bucket is pivotable downwardly between a closed position and an open position and also can be positioned in an intermediate open position between the open and closed positions. The first assist spring is configured to maintain the bucket in the intermediate open position. When a downward force greater than the spring force is placed on the bucket, the bucket is configured to move from the intermediate open position to the open position.

  • Patent number: 9174734
    Abstract: A pivot bin assembly configured to receive luggage and be positioned in the interior of an aircraft. The pivot bin assembly includes an upper housing that includes a strongback and first and second side panels, a bucket that cooperates with the upper housing to define a bin interior, a first pivot mechanism operatively associated with the first side panel and the bucket, and a second pivot mechanism operatively associated with the second side panel and the bucket. The first and second pivot mechanisms are axially aligned along a pivot axis such that the bucket pivots about the pivot axis with respect to the upper housing between an open position and a closed position.
